Colección de citas famosas - Frases motivadoras - Los pasos principales del diseño de una base de datos no incluyen

Los pasos principales del diseño de una base de datos no incluyen

Los principales pasos del diseño de una base de datos no incluyen: diseño de algoritmos.

Los pasos del diseño de la base de datos son los siguientes:

Etapa de análisis de requisitos: recopilación y análisis de requisitos y, como resultado, los requisitos de datos descritos por el diccionario de datos (y los requisitos de procesamiento descritos). según el diagrama de flujo de datos). Etapa de diseño de estructura conceptual: mediante la síntesis, generalización y abstracción de las necesidades del usuario, se forma un modelo conceptual independiente del DBMS específico, que puede representarse mediante un diagrama E-R.

Fase de diseño de la estructura lógica: Convertir la estructura conceptual en un modelo de datos soportado por DBMS (como un modelo relacional) y optimizarlo. Fase de diseño físico de la base de datos: seleccione una estructura física (incluida la estructura de almacenamiento y el método de acceso) que sea más adecuada para el entorno de aplicación del modelo de datos lógico.

Fase de implementación de la base de datos: utilice el lenguaje de datos (como SQL) y su lenguaje host (como C) proporcionado por el DBMS para establecer la base de datos en función de los resultados del diseño lógico y físico, compilar y depure la aplicación y almacene los datos en la base de datos. Realice una ejecución de prueba. Etapa de operación y mantenimiento de la base de datos: el sistema de aplicación de la base de datos se puede poner en operación formal después de la operación de prueba. Los sistemas de bases de datos deben evaluarse, ajustarse y modificarse continuamente durante su funcionamiento.

El diseño de bases de datos se refiere a la construcción de un modelo de base de datos óptimo para un entorno de aplicación determinado, estableciendo una base de datos y su sistema de aplicación, de modo que pueda almacenar datos de manera efectiva y satisfacer las necesidades de aplicaciones de varios usuarios (necesidades de información y procesamiento). necesidades). En el campo de las bases de datos, varios sistemas que utilizan bases de datos a menudo se denominan sistemas de aplicación de bases de datos.